    Description
    Duties


    • Evaluate diagnoses and treat the full range of patients with disorders described in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ders.
    • Participate in and, as assigned oversees program education, process improvement functions and various managed care processes.
    • Provide training and supervision of mental health providers and assist in the management of their complex cases.
    • Prepare briefings and articulately delivers them to leadership.
    • Participate in care conferences and provide input for planning treatment programs to assure patient and family return to optimal health and wellness.
    • Maintain paper and electronic medical records on patients during tour of duty including data entry and retrieval

    Basic Requirement for Psychologist Position:
    Degree: Doctoral Degree (Ph.
    D
    or equivalent) directly related to full professional work in clinical psychology
    In addition to meeting the basic requirement above, to qualify for this position you must also meet the qualification requirements listed below:

    Specialized Experience:
    One year of specialized experience which includes administering and interpreting psychological tests; evaluating effectiveness of programs; and conducting therapeutic interventions
    This definition of specialized experience is typical of work performed at the next lower grade/level position in the federal service (GS-12)
    Some federal jobs allow you to substitute your education for the required experience in order to qualify
    For this job, you must meet the qualification requirement using experience aloneno substitution of education for experience is permitted
